This is a mesh grease filter that fits inside an over-the-range microwave to capture grease and airborne particles from stovetop cooking before they enter the ventilation system. It helps keep the microwave interior and exhaust ductwork clean. Replace this filter if it is visibly clogged with grease buildup, discolored, or no longer effectively trapping grease during cooking.

This is an air deflector arm that directs airflow within the microwave to help manage ventilation and cooling during operation. It ensures heated air is routed properly to protect internal components and maintain efficient performance. Replace this part if it is cracked, warped, or missing, which can lead to overheating or uneven ventilation inside the microwave.
